The Speed Imperative in Electrical Distribution

Electrical contractors view response time as the primary indicator of a distributor’s reliability. In an industry where downtime costs thousands per hour, a delayed answer to a part availability query is effectively a lost job.

This is no longer just about having a phone number or an email address; it is about instantaneous information access. Contractors expect real-time answers to lead times, shipping status, and inventory levels the moment they ask.

Traditional support models simply cannot meet this demand. Human agents are overwhelmed by routine questions, leading to bottlenecks that frustrate customers and stall projects. The solution lies in shifting from simple automation to agentic AI that handles these routine queries instantly.

By allowing AI to manage Part A interactions, distributors can free up human staff for complex, high-value technical issues. This hybrid approach ensures that every contractor feels heard immediately, building loyalty and driving sales.

Let’s look at the data behind this shift.

The cost of delay in electrical distribution is measurable and significant. When a contractor calls or chats, they are often on a job site, not in an office. Every minute spent on hold is a minute not working, and potentially a competitor’s inquiry being answered elsewhere.

Research confirms that speed is the #1 driver of customer satisfaction in support interactions. According to ChatMaxima’s 2026 industry report, companies leveraging AI have successfully cut First Response Time by up to 74%.

This isn’t just a metric; it’s a competitive moat. Consider a mid-sized distributor that receives 500 inquiries daily. Without AI, their team might take hours to respond to routine stock checks. With AI handling the initial triage, those same inquiries are resolved in seconds.

Furthermore, ZDNet’s analysis of agentic AI highlights that autonomous AI resolution leads to an average 20% decrease in overall case resolution time.

This speed is crucial because ChatMaxima notes that 51% of consumers prefer bots for immediate service. Delaying that immediate service means losing the customer’s trust before a human agent even speaks.

The old model of "chatbots" that follow rigid decision trees is obsolete. Today’s electrical distributors need agentic AI capable of executing multi-step workflows across inventory and logistics systems.

This technology doesn’t just answer questions; it acts. It can check real-time stock, calculate lead times, and even initiate shipping labels without human intervention.

Key capabilities include:

  • Real-Time Inventory Checks: Accessing live stock levels across multiple warehouses instantly.
  • Lead Time Calculation: Providing accurate delivery dates based on current supplier data.
  • Order Status Tracking: Giving proactive updates without the contractor having to ask.
  • Complex Query Routing: Seamlessly transferring technical issues to human experts with full context.

By automating these routine tasks, distributors can scale support without proportional headcount increases. In fact, ChatMaxima statistics reveal that 80% of routine customer interactions will be fully handled by AI in 2026.

This shift allows human staff to focus on complex technical troubleshooting and relationship building, rather than data entry.

The Data Infrastructure Barrier

Most electrical distributors fail to realize that AI chatbots cannot function in a vacuum. Without connected systems, your AI agents are blind to real-time inventory levels, leading to frustrating "I don't know" responses for contractors who need parts immediately.

This disconnect creates a significant operational bottleneck. Contractors expect instant answers about part availability and lead times, but legacy software silos prevent AI from accessing this critical data.

According to Desk365 research, 44% of companies are now prioritizing data integration specifically to enable personalization and accurate service.

Experts warn that 2026 will be the year organizations confront the "data drought" created by AI, highlighting data infrastructure as a critical constraint for businesses.

Personalization and accurate responses are impossible without connected data. When AI tools operate with limited context, they cannot distinguish between a simple status check and a complex technical inquiry.

This lack of integration leads to the "data drought" risk, where AI generates plausible but incorrect information because it lacks access to your ERP or inventory databases.

As reported by CX Today, infrastructure readiness is the primary predictor of whether an AI deployment will succeed or fail.

To avoid this pitfall, distributors must ensure their CRM, inventory management, and order tracking systems are fully unified before deploying any AI agents.

When data is siloed, your support team spends hours manually checking stock levels instead of letting AI handle it instantly. This inefficiency negates the potential speed benefits of AI technology.

Consider a distributor that deploys a chatbot without API connections to their inventory system. The bot might promise a part is in stock when it is not, leading to angry contractors and lost revenue.

Real-time data synchronization is the non-negotiable foundation for any AI customer support strategy in the distribution sector.

A concrete example of this barrier is evident in how 77% of companies with AI agents still allow customers to connect with human agents at any point to maintain trust, often because the AI lacks complete data context according to ZDNet.

The Hybrid 'Connected Rep' Model

Stop viewing AI as a replacement for your support team and start seeing it as their most powerful assistant. The most effective strategy for electrical distributors is a hybrid "Connected Rep" model where AI acts as an intelligent layer over existing inventory and logistics systems.

This approach allows AI to handle routine inquiries like part availability and shipping instantly, while human agents focus on complex, high-value technical issues. By combining speed with expertise, you can reduce First Response Time by up to 74% while maintaining the high-touch service contractors expect.

AI doesn’t just answer questions; it prepares your human staff for success. When a contractor calls with a complex technical issue, the AI has already gathered their order history and current ticket status. This eliminates repetitive data gathering, allowing your team to solve problems faster and more accurately.

According to recent analysis, this "deeper process automation" improves contact center efficiency by up to 30% by equipping human agents with unified customer profiles. Instead of searching through multiple systems, your staff receives a context-rich summary the moment a connection is made.

Key benefits include:

  • Instant Context: AI provides immediate order history and previous interactions to human agents.
  • Reduced Handle Time: Agents spend less time researching and more time solving.
  • Seamless Handoffs: Complex queries transfer to humans without the customer repeating information.
  • Higher Accuracy: Agents have real-time access to inventory data during conversations.

Consumers demand speed, but they also require transparency and trust. A fully automated system that traps users in loops will damage your reputation, whereas a hybrid model builds loyalty. 77% of companies with AI agents allow customers to connect with human agents at any point to maintain trust and ensure complex issues are resolved properly.

Your AI should clearly identify itself and offer an easy path to human assistance. This transparency satisfies the 61% of new buyers who choose faster AI responses but still value the safety net of human expertise. When contractors know they can reach a person, they are more likely to engage with the AI for quick checks.

To ensure a trustworthy environment, prioritize these governance steps:

  • Clear Labeling: Explicitly state when a customer is interacting with an AI agent.
  • Easy Escalation: Provide one-click options to transfer to a human representative.
  • Security Oversight: Monitor AI actions to prevent errors, as over 50% of agents currently run without proper security controls.
  • Human-in-the-Loop: Configure the system to flag sensitive or high-value transactions for human review.

Consider an electrical distributor implementing this model for after-hours support. An AI agent instantly answers a contractor’s question about lead times for specific breakers. If the contractor asks about a complex wiring configuration, the AI seamlessly transfers the call to a human specialist who already has the product details loaded.

This hybrid approach reduces case resolution time by an average of 20% while ensuring customers feel heard and valued. It transforms support from a cost center into a competitive advantage that retains loyal contractors.
